The National Monuments Service's description

On a low sand and gravel ridge. Marked on the OS 6-inch maps as a subcircular enclosure (c. 37m NE-SW; c. 34m NW-SE). On inspection in May 1986 no visible surface trace survived. According to the landowner, the area was quarried out c. 1960 and as a result the ground level had been lowered by several metres. A house has since been built on the site. Possibly a ringfort.
